Can dandelion wine be made without adding yeast?

Yes, dandelion wine can be made without adding yeast. It is possible to naturally ferment the sugars in the dandelions to create alcohol. However, this process will take much longer than if yeast is added. Adding yeast will speed up the fermentation process and result in a higher alcohol content.
